I've dedicated 25 years to working with young people, and 12 years in the EDUCATION SERVICE.

 

With this passion, I've inspired young people to participate in physical activities through PE, football coaching and running sports camps. Through this experience - I've upskilled myself in many other settings from learning support worker, to behaviour mentor, P.E. leader and different roles. 
 

I have acquired the ability to tackle and encourage students to understand the importance of physical education. I believe sports should be delivered in a fun way - with young people still learning simultaneously so they are still being challenged. PE should be inclusive and child-friendly, so children can excel and be inspired. 

​

Through coaching, I've developed empathy to motivate young people to give more effort, and increase their confidence, and even their self-worth!
